Как создать таблицу в MySQL: шаги и примеры

👋 Привет! Чтобы создать таблицу в MySQL, тебе понадобится использовать оператор CREATE TABLE.

Вот пример кода, который позволит тебе создать таблицу с названием "students":


CREATE TABLE students (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(50),
    age INT,
    email VARCHAR(100)
);
    

В этом примере мы создаем таблицу с четырьмя столбцами - 'id', 'name', 'age' и 'email'. Первый столбец 'id' имеет тип данных INT и он будет автоматически увеличиваться с каждой новой записью с помощью ключевого слова AUTO_INCREMENT. Также мы указываем, что столбец 'id' является PRIMARY KEY, что означает, что он будет использоваться для уникальной идентификации каждой записи.

После ключевого слова CREATE TABLE мы указываем название таблицы ('students'), а затем в скобках описываем структуру таблицы - каждый столбец с его названием и типом данных. Мы также можем указать ограничения и свойства для каждого столбца, например, ограничение на максимальную длину VARCHAR или NOT NULL для обязательного заполнения поля.

Так что вот, теперь ты знаешь, как создавать таблицы в MySQL! Если у тебя есть еще вопросы, не стесняйся задавать. Удачи в изучении!

Детальный ответ

Привет! В этой статье я хочу поделиться с тобой подробной информацией о том, как создавать таблицы в MySQL. MySQL - это одна из самых популярных систем управления базами данных, и знание, как создавать таблицы, является фундаментальным для понимания работы с этой базой данных.

Шаг 1: Создание базы данных

Перед тем, как мы начнем создавать таблицы, нам нужно создать базу данных, в которой они будут храниться. Здесь приведен пример создания базы данных с именем "mydatabase":

CREATE DATABASE mydatabase;

После создания базы данных мы можем перейти к следующему шагу - созданию таблицы.

Шаг 2: Создание таблицы

Вот базовый синтаксис для создания таблицы в MySQL:

CREATE TABLE table_name (
    column1 datatype,
    column2 datatype,
    column3 datatype,
    ...
    );

Давай разберем этот синтаксис по шагам:

  • CREATE TABLE - это ключевое слово, которое указывает на то, что мы хотим создать новую таблицу.
  • table_name - здесь мы указываем имя таблицы, которую хотим создать. Имя таблицы должно быть уникальным в пределах базы данных.
  • column1, column2, column3 - здесь мы указываем названия столбцов, которые будут присутствовать в таблице. Каждый столбец разделяется запятой.
  • datatype - здесь мы указываем тип данных для каждого столбца. Например, "INT" для целочисленных значений или "VARCHAR(50)" для строковых значений с максимальной длиной 50 символов.

Давай рассмотрим пример создания простой таблицы с именем "users", содержащей два столбца "id" и "name":

CREATE TABLE users (
    id INT,
    name VARCHAR(50)
    );

Теперь у нас есть база данных и таблица, но они пока не содержат данных. Давай перейдем к следующему шагу и добавим некоторые данные в нашу таблицу.

Шаг 3: Вставка данных в таблицу

Чтобы добавить данные в таблицу, мы используем оператор INSERT INTO. Вот пример его использования:

INSERT INTO table_name (column1, column2, column3, ...)
    VALUES (value1, value2, value3, ...);

Давай рассмотрим пример добавления данных в таблицу "users":

INSERT INTO users (id, name)
    VALUES (1, 'John'),
           (2, 'Jane'),
           (3, 'Bob');

Теперь у нас есть таблица "users" с тремя записями внутри.

Шаг 4: Просмотр данных в таблице

Чтобы просмотреть данные в таблице, мы используем оператор SELECT. Вот пример его использования:

SELECT * FROM table_name;

Данный пример вернет все записи из таблицы. Если нам нужны только определенные столбцы, мы можем указать их имена вместо символа "*".

Вот пример просмотра всех записей из таблицы "users":

SELECT * FROM users;

Результатом будет вывод всех записей в таблице "users".

Шаг 5: Изменение таблицы

Иногда нам может потребоваться внести изменения в структуру таблицы. Например, мы можем захотеть добавить новый столбец или изменить тип данных столбца. Для этого используется оператор ALTER TABLE. Вот пример его использования:

ALTER TABLE table_name
    ADD column_name datatype;

Давай рассмотрим пример добавления нового столбца с именем "email" в таблицу "users":

ALTER TABLE users
    ADD email VARCHAR(50);

Теперь у нас есть новый столбец "email" в таблице "users".

В заключение

В этой статье мы подробно рассмотрели, как создавать таблицы в MySQL. Мы начали с создания базы данных, затем перешли к созданию таблицы, добавлению данных и просмотру содержимого таблицы. Также мы обсудили изменение структуры таблицы с помощью оператора ALTER TABLE.

Уверен, что с этой информацией тебе будет легче разбираться с созданием таблиц в MySQL. И помни, чем больше практики, тем лучше! Удачи в изучении баз данных!

Видео по теме

How to create new Database and Table in MySQL WorkBench

MySQL: How to create a TABLE

How to Create a Database, Add Tables and Import Data in MySQL Workbench

Похожие статьи:

Как подключить MySQL к PHP: пошаговое руководство для начинающих

Как создать таблицу в MySQL: шаги и примеры